A Regular Meeting of the Exeter Zoning Board of Review was held on Thursday, March 12, 2020 at 7:30 pm, in the Town Council Chambers of the Exeter Town Hall, 675 Ten Rod Road, Exeter, RI.

 

Members present:     Richard Booth, Richard Quattromani, Tom McMillan, Tim Robertson, Susan Franco-Towell and Susan Littlefield

Members absent:       Joe St. Lawrence (recused)

Others present:           Ron Ronzio, Stenographer, Stephen Sypole, Solicitor and Dixie Foisy, Clerk

 

Meeting called to order at 7:30 pm by Chairman Richard Booth

 

Chairman Booth requested a motion to open the public hearing.  Motion made by Mr. Robertson, seconded by Mr. McMillan; voted all in favor. MOTION PASSED.

 

Chairman Booth stated that we had a recusal for the record; Joseph St. Lawrence recused himself from the hearing of the proposed 20’ x 24’ shed.

Chairman Booth asked if the appropriate recusal paperwork had been completed. The clerk stated it was being completed at the time for the record.

Solicitor Sypole noted that Joseph St. Lawrence who is a member of the Zoning Board is the applicant

tonight and he did request an advisory opinion from the Ethics Commission to allow him to represent himself and also to recuse himself from the hearing tonight.

Chairman Booth noted that the advisory opinion #2020-15 was approved on 3/3/2020 by the RI Ethics Committee signed by Marissa Quinn and has been marked as exhibit A for the record.  Additionally, a letter from Joseph St. Lawrence to the RI Ethics Commission has been marked at exhibit B for the record.

 

Chairman Booth read the first petition as follows:

 

The petition of Joseph St. Lawrence; Applicant and owner for property at 316A Hog House Hill Road Exeter, RI.; Zoned RU-4, and further designated as Assessor’s Plat 64 Block 1 Lot 20; a request for dimensional relief under Zoning Ordinance Article II Section 2.4.2.1/.2/.4/.6; for a proposed 20’x 24’ shed.

Mr. Joseph St. Lawrence was present and sworn in.  Mr. St. Lawrence stated he wants to construct a

20 x 24 shed.  He asked the board to look at his site plan to see that this is the only location on the lot to build because the septic is in the back of the house and the well is on the left side of the house. Chairman Booth asked if the shed would be used for storage.  Mr. St. Lawrence responded yes that it is just for storage.

Mr. McMillan asked about the existing shed on the property.  Mr. St. Lawrence responded that he will be tearing it down.

Mr. Robertson asked Mr. St. Lawrence about his property being in a RU-4 zone and inquired if his 2- acre  lot  is  an  existing  pre-approved,  non-conforming  lot.    Mr.  St.  Lawrence  responded  in  the affirmative.

Chairman Booth stated that for the record, Susan Littlefield was appointed as the first alternate for voting purposes.

Mr. Quattromani discussed the criteria that the Board must consider when granting dimensional relief. Chairman Booth asked if anyone was present to speak either for or against this petition. There was no public comment.

 

Chairman Booth requested a motion to close the public meeting.  Mr. Robertson made a motion; Mr. Quattromani seconded. Voted all in favor. Motion passed.

 

Mr. Quattromani made a motion to grant the petition of Joseph St. Lawrence; Applicant and owner for property at 316A Hog House Hill Road Exeter, RI.; Zoned RU-4, and further designated as Assessor’s Plat 64 Block 1 Lot 20; a request for dimensional relief under Zoning Ordinance Article II Section 2.4.2.1

relief of 2.2 acres;  Section 2.4.2.2 frontage relief of 50 feet; Section 2.4.2.4 front setback relief of

18 feet; Section 2.4.2.6 right setback relief of 58 feet; Section 2.4.2.6 left setback relief of 29 feet per the documents and drawings that were submitted during this application.

 

Chairman Booth stated that we have a motion by Mr. Quattromani; Mr. Robertson seconded.  Voted all in favor. Motion carries.

 

Solicitor Sypole requested that the letter from the RI Ethics Commission (exhibit A) be recorded along with the decision.
